STRA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2014 in Review

143 of the 3,446 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Strategic Education (STRA) for Q3 2014, worth a combined $625M — up 15% from $542M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 16 funds opened new STRA positions and 15 closed out — a net gain of 1 holder — while 41 added to existing stakes and 58 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Marshfield Associates, opening a new position worth an estimated $9.84M. The largest seller was Royce & Associates, cutting an estimated $18.6M.
